Output ef44e6a24fa65804c7e7283e74afa4c4575a43b156fe89c0c9712b6970cf2ca7:4

value
2411646
script pubkey
OP_0 OP_PUSHBYTES_32 8596db60fe1bd0ccdf84346fe78509a67f51eceba07178dc0ba983612d81a7b1
address
bc1qsktdkc87r0gvehuyx3h70pgf5el4rm8t5pch3hqt4xpkztvp57cs855qxu
transaction
ef44e6a24fa65804c7e7283e74afa4c4575a43b156fe89c0c9712b6970cf2ca7
confirmations
122195
spent
true